Modi's Diplomatic and Infrastructure Push

Modi Leadership Analysis
Show Notes
This episode of "Modi Leadership Analysis" delves into Prime Minister Narendra Modi's strategic leadership and policy initiatives that are shaping India's domestic development and enhancing its global standing. The discussion highlights Modi's diplomatic efforts to strengthen India's ties with countries like Malaysia, Japan, and Seychelles, aiming to bolster defense, security, and strategic partnerships, particularly in the Indo-Pacific region. Key sources such as The Times of India and The Economic Times provide insights into Modi's recent diplomatic engagements and their broader implications for India's regional influence.
Additionally, the episode examines Modi's focus on infrastructural development, including the setting of quality improvement deadlines for highways, emphasizing his commitment to improving physical connectivity, facilitating economic growth, and ensuring inclusivity. Modi's engagement with World Radio Day showcases his appreciation for traditional media's role in governance and public communication, highlighting his multifaceted leadership approach.
